What if you woke up one morning, feeling whole, like a half of you had just suddenly been filled? And if you heard a voice in your head saying 'Hi' and asking 'What's your name' as if this was normal. Well in this world, it is normal. When a person comes of age, they are linked with another person in the world that can hear what they say and feel what they feel. However, when Marissa finally hits puberty, she's shocked to discover she's a GenBen. Someone with an opposite gender for a duplicate. While she sees no problem with it, the rare occurrence makes her and her duplicate Jake, freaks amongst their peers. 

Ridiculed where ever she goes, Marissa is left broken and blistered. So when running away seems like the only solution, she says goodbye to everything she's ever known and hits the road.

Most people won't go out of their way to find their duplicate, but those who do, end-up on the adventure of a lifetime.
